Game Overview

A hostile maze is the entire stage for a compact horror experience built around uncertainty, isolation, and the fear of taking one more wrong turn. Convolution of Fear begins with an amnesiac awakening in a grim network of corridors, offering little explanation beyond the urgent need to find a way out. The atmosphere stays oppressive rather than action-driven: distant sounds, unsettling whispers, and the constant suggestion of an unseen presence make even quiet stretches feel unsafe.

Progress comes from pushing through the labyrinth, learning its passages, watching for routes forward, and keeping your bearings when the environment turns confusion into a threat. Danger can arrive without warning, so the tension comes less from mastery of weapons or elaborate systems and more from nerve, patience, and a willingness to continue after being startled. Getting lost is part of the challenge, and the game leans into the frustration of searching through dark, threatening spaces where every sound may be a clue or a trap. Persistence matters, as escaping requires players to resist panic and gradually make sense of an environment designed to disorient them.

What stands out is its stripped-back commitment to maze horror: the setting itself acts as the enemy, while the unknown creature or force stalking the corridors supplies the pressure. Rather than offering a broad narrative adventure, it focuses on the primal appeal of navigating darkness with limited certainty, making successful progress feel earned. Fans of claustrophobic indie horror and maze-based scare games should find its relentless unease appealing, while players who dislike getting lost, repeated dead ends, or sudden scares may find the experience more exhausting than entertaining.
